Skip to content

VocaDB/VocaDB-App

Folders and files

NameName
Last commit message
Last commit date

Latest commit

18d31dc · Mar 14, 2024
Dec 9, 2023
Dec 9, 2023
Mar 13, 2024
Dec 9, 2023
Dec 9, 2023
Mar 14, 2024
Dec 9, 2023
Dec 9, 2023
Mar 14, 2024
Dec 9, 2023
Dec 9, 2023
Dec 10, 2023
Dec 9, 2023
Dec 9, 2023
Dec 9, 2023
Dec 9, 2023
Mar 13, 2024
Mar 13, 2024

Repository files navigation

VocaDB App

VocaDB mobile version with Flutter framework.

Download

VocaDB

TouhouDB

Getting started for development

Prerequisite

  • Flutter (Currently this project use version 3.3)
  • Run flutter doctor

Install package dependencies

$ flutter pub get

Test

Run unit tests

$ flutter test

With coverage report

$ flutter test --coverage

Build

WIP

Translation / Localization

Create new language (For anyone)

  1. Create new .arb file in ${FLUTTER_PROJECT}/lib/src/localization. File format will be app_{lang_code}_{country_code}.arb.
  2. Copy file content from app_en.arb as template and then edit on your own language.

Edit existing language

You can edit file inside ${FLUTTER_PROJECT}/lib/src/localization.

Run codegen (For developer)

$ flutter gen-l10n

Reference